Result: Regent's Park & Kensington North

  LAB HOLD


News image
TOP THREE PARTIES AT A GLANCE
LabourLabour44.7%
ConservativeConservative29.7%
Liberal DemocratLiberal Democrat18.6%
Swing: 6.3% from LAB to CON
IN DETAIL
NamePartyVotes%+/- %
Karen BuckLabour18,19644.7-9.9
Jeremy BradshawConservative12,06529.7+2.8
Rabi MartinsLiberal Democrat7,56918.6+6.0
Paul MillerGreen1,9854.9+1.5
Pamela PerrinUK Independence Party4561.1+0.1
Rezouk BoufasCivilisation Party2270.6+0.6
Abby DharamseyIndependent1820.4+0.4
Majority6,13115.1 
Turnout40,68051.5+2.7
